Default How do I send a copy via email in Word 2007 from a template?

I've added several custom word docs as .dot files, and I regularly contact
business leads by New, Document, from Template (Now from Trusted Template),
then filling in fields, tweaking the copy for the recipient, then hitting the
'email' icon. The to and from fields appear, along with a button labeled
'Send a Copy'. This functionality has been in Word since at least 2002.

I can't find it anywhere now. I"ve been on the new Word 2007 website,
scoured the help files...suggestions please? The only option I see is to
send it as an email attachment, and that attaches a Word_Template_ to the
email...not the way 'send a copy' has worked for a long time. I want to
display the text as normal email text, no attachment that gets stripped out
or unread by incompatible email clients.

You can add the Email command to your Quick Access Toolbar:

- Right-click the Ribbon and select Customize Quick Access Toolbar
- In the Choose Commands From drop down select "Commands Not in the
Ribbon"
- Locate the Email command
- Click the Add button to add it to your QAT

The fact that there is a "Commands not in the ribbon" category for the
QAT is helpful. If you find what you're looking for there you'll know
it isn't in the UI.
